Output 3c44a5b43f64dd0aff0d051c3b903b76236de587e32fa195d41c18bf70d73c51: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d87d9e07e6c16c2ccc1b566f76e91cfa8ebca0 OP_EQUAL
address
3B4pC9WPWPZVya1vmKdxYgNDesZeCHg1Ks
transaction
3c44a5b43f64dd0aff0d051c3b903b76236de587e32fa195d41c18bf70d73c51
spent
true